1. Discover Sydney’s Iconic Harbour
Sydney boasts one of the most beautiful harbors in the world. Renting a yacht provides the opportunity to sail past the famous Sydney Opera House and the Sydney Harbour Bridge. You can anchor at locations like Darling Harbour or enjoy a sunset cruise around the Harbour, soaking in the lively atmosphere. Many yacht rental companies offer guided tours, giving insights into the city’s history while you cruise on the sparkling waters.

4. Unwind in Perth’s Coastal Bliss
Perth is often referred to as Australia’s sunniest capital, and its stunning beaches make it an ideal destination for yacht tourism. Sail along the Swan River or venture out to the sparkling waters of the Indian Ocean. Visitors can anchor at nearby islands like Rottnest Island, known for its picturesque beaches and unique wildlife. A yacht gives you the freedom to enjoy water sports, beach picnics, and tranquil swimming spots away from the crowd.

6. Engage with Local Wildlife in Hobart
Hobart, the capital of Tasmania, is surrounded by stunning natural beauty and is an excellent destination for yacht tourism. Explore the breathtaking landscapes of the Derwent River or sail towards Bruny Island to witness unique wildlife, including seals and seabirds. Many yacht tours also include gourmet meals featuring local produce, making it a delightful way to experience Tasmania’s culinary scene.
